Procedures for Addressing the Council
The Council encourages interested people to address this legislative body by making a brief presentation on a public hearing item when the Mayor calls the item or address other items under Matters from the Audience. State Law prohibits the City Council from responding to or acting upon matters not listed on this agenda.

The Council encourages free expression of all points of view. To allow all persons the opportunity to speak, please keep your remarks brief. If others have already expressed your position, you may simply indicate that you agree with a previous speaker. If appropriate, a spokesperson may present the views of your entire group. Council rules prohibit clapping, booing or shouts of approval or disagreement from the audience. Please silence all cell phones and other electronic equipment while the Council is in session. Thank you.

Written comments may be submitted in advance of the meeting by emailing cityclerksgroup@cityofbrea.net. Written comments received by 3 p.m. on the day of the meeting will be provided to the Council, will be made available to the public at the meeting, and will be included in the official record of the meeting.

CITY COUNCIL - CONSENT
 
16.   July 18, 2023 City Council Regular Meeting Minutes - Approve. 
 
17.   Adoption of Ordinance No. 1241 – Zoning Ordinance Text Amendment No. 2023-01 (Omnibus Zoning Code Update) - Staff recommends that the City Council take the following action: Waive full reading and adopt Ordinance No. 1241 titled “An Ordinance of the City Council of the City of Brea Amending the Brea City Code by Adopting Zoning Ordinance Text Amendment ZOTA No. 2023-01 (Omnibus Zoning Code Update) and Approving a CEQA Exemption Determination”. The costs to process and implement the Project are included in the FY2023/2024 Community Development Department budget.
 
18.   Adoption of Ordinance No. 1242 – Zoning Ordinance Text Amendment No. 2023-02 (Housing Element Implementation Program Code Update) - Staff recommends that the City Council take the following action: Waive full reading and adopt Ordinance No. 1242 titled “An Ordinance of the City Council of the City of Brea Amending the Brea City Code by Adopting Zoning Ordinance Text Amendment ZOTA No. 2023-02 (Housing Element Program Implementation Code Update) and Approving a CEQA Exemption Determination”. The costs to process and implement the Project are included in the FY2023/2024 Community Development Department budget.
 
19.   Adoption of Ordinance No. 1243, renewing Ordinance No.1227 and approving the Police Department's Military Equipment Use policy - Adopt Ordinance No. 1243, titled "An Ordinance of the City of Brea Renewing Ordinance No. 1227 (Military Equipment Use Policy Approval)". There is no fiscal impact to the General Fund.
 
20.   Maintenance Agreement with Sancon Technologies Inc. for Placement of Cured-in-Place Pipe (CIPP) and Manhole Rehabilitation - Award contract to Sancon Technologies Inc. for Placement of Cured-in-Place Pipe (CIPP) and Manhole Rehabilitation at identified locations within the City of Brea for a period of one year, with the opportunity to renew the contract for four additional years, and Authorize the City manager to approve contract renewals. Public Works budgets $300,000 per year in CIP accounts Fund 510 for this work. There is no cost to the General Fund and no additional appropriation is needed.
 
21.   Agreement for Production of Original Art Work with Carlos Terres for the Reproduction of the Centennial Door Sculpture - 1) Approve the Agreement for Production of Original Artwork with Carlos Terres for the Reproduction of the Centennial Door bronze sculpture; and 2) Appropriate $85,000 from the Fixed Asset Replacement Fund (182) for the purchase of the sculpture.The cost of this purchase is $85,000. There is funding available in the Fixed Asset Replacement Fund (182) and staff is recommending to appropriate funding and authorize this contract.
 
22.   Dispatch Services – La Habra Police Department - Approve the Memorandum of Understanding between the City of Brea and the City of La Habra to assist with dispatch services and the training of La Habra Police Dispatchers.  There is no fiscal impact to the General Fund.
 
23.   Investment Policy Guidelines for the City of Brea's Employee Benefits Fund Pension Plan - Review and approve the Investment Policy Guidelines for the City of Brea's Employee Benefits Fund Pension Plan through Public Agencies Retirement Services (PARS). There is no fiscal impact to the General Fund.
 
24.   Investment Policy Guidelines for the City of Brea's Other Post Employments Benefits (OPEB) Trust Fund - Review and approve the Investment Guidelines for the City's Other Post Employment Benefits (OPEB) Trust Fund through Public Agency Retirement Services (PARS). There is no fiscal impact to the General Fund.
